Upright Keywords: The beginning of a journey, a leap into the unknown, a fresh start, a clean slate, a wonderful beginning, innocence, spontaneity, potential, a new chance, a new way of perceiving the world, an opportunity, an important decision, a surprising solution, the start of an adventure, significant and unexpected circumstances, time for a change, originality, purity of action, being born again, taking a risk, confidence that you are headed in the right direction.
People: A new born, a child, those who are starting anew, dreamers, adventures, visionaries, travelers, wonderers, eccentrics independent and controversial people. Bisexual or homosexual people, someone about to make an important decision or begin a journey, those who herald the beginning of a new phase in their lives.
Situation & Advice: The Fool appears when you are about to embark on a new phase of your life. It is time to cast away doubts and fears that often arise when leaving the well-trodden ways. You are or will be experiencing mixed feelings about the old and new. Listen to your instincts and you will find you have a clear feeling about people and situations that need to be left behind and you would be wise to leave these things in the past and get on with something new.
An unexpected opportunity may appear out of the blue but upon reflection you will realize that the opportunity has been right in front of you for sometime, but you now have to make a decision about this opportunity and it can lead you down new paths. The people you meet now may be participants in a new cycle of personal and professional growth. The Fool may represent a bisexual or homosexual person who will influence the situation.
It is both a challenging and exciting time in your life. The Fool is a wise card which has it's own special disruptive timing making plans go awry. Expect a shake up and a bit of fun. Think all matters through as best you can then trust your feelings about what to do next.
**On occasion The Fool will signify embarking on an actual journey, especially if other travel cards appear in the spread. (The Chariot, The Wheel of Fortune, The World, Six of Swords, Eight of Wands and The Knight of Wands)** |

Reversed Keywords: Foolishness, Fear of the unknown, impulsiveness, poor judgment, risk, inexperience, gullibility, unfounded optimism, irresponsibility, lack of foresight, wasting energy, excessive conformity, lack of perspective, poor decisions, head in the clouds, an obsession, throwing caution to the wind, playing with fire, look before you leap.
People: Gamblers, the foolhardy, the uncommitted, the reckless.
Situation & Advice: When reversed The Fool warns against taking risks unless you carefully consider the situation. You need to stop, look and listen. You become confused by too many details and miss the obvious. Your current situation causes you to fear the unknown or what the future may bring. Avoid excessive optimism and blinding yourself to the downside risk of the adventure. An impulsive decision or unwise gamble is not in your favor. Unexpected problems may arise and you may find yourself in a precarious situation brought on by your own or someone else's folly. Your judgment may be faulty or you are not receiving good advice. Someone around you is making foolish decisions. You are not using enough foresight to ensure genuine happiness.
The Fool reversed can represent that the path you're now on will have delays or troubles, or you will make unwise choices along the way. Foolhardy or thoughtless actions can lead to unsatisfactory experiences, and wanting freedom or anything too fast or too soon can mean you won't be able to handle what is coming into your life later on down the road. |
